Canada and Mexico Face Off Over Trump’s Tariff Threat


President-elect’s new trade and border policies are causing tensions within the North American alliance. The United States, under the new leadership, is taking a tough stance on trade and border talks with its neighbors, which is creating friction within the region.

The president-elect’s decisions have sparked controversy and concern among leaders in Canada and Mexico, as they fear that their economies will be negatively impacted by these new policies. This has led to increased tensions between the three countries, putting the future of the North American alliance in question.

The trade and border talks are crucial for the economic stability of the region, as well as for the flow of goods and services between the countries. Any disruption in these talks could have severe consequences for all three nations, leading to potential trade wars and economic instability.

Leaders in Canada and Mexico are urging the president-elect to reconsider his stance and work towards finding a mutually beneficial solution that will benefit all parties involved. They are emphasizing the importance of maintaining strong relationships and cooperation within the North American alliance to ensure continued economic growth and stability.

As the president-elect continues to push forward with his trade and border policies, it remains to be seen how the North American alliance will navigate these challenges. It is crucial for all parties involved to work together towards finding common ground and resolving any differences in order to maintain a strong and prosperous partnership.
